Mary Russell is a fictional character and the protagonist of the Mary Russell & Sherlock Holmes mystery series by American author Laurie R. King. She first appears in the novel The Beekeeper's Apprentice.
Mary Judith Russell Holmes is a detective and theologian. She starts out in the first book as a 15-year-old orphan, literally stumbling over Sherlock Holmes while hiking in Sussex. Over the course of several years she becomes his apprentice, colleague, confidante, and finally his wife.

In this novel, King presents the first meeting between fifteen-year-old Mary Russell, the young Jewish-American protagonist, and Sherlock Holmes. Their meeting leads to a collaboration between the two, though this first novel focuses primarily on the detective training that Holmes gives to Russell.

Mary Russell is a fictional detective featured in a series of books by American novelist Laurie R. King. The series is written in past-tense by an older Mary Russell, who tells her memoirs from about 1915 to 1920. She meets a middle-aged version of the famous detective Sherlock Holmes, who becomes her mentor.
